How they compare
Serbia currently reports 95.92 against 94.81 in Armenia, a difference of 1.11.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 9 shared years of data; in 2010 it was Armenia ahead.
Armenia ranks 44th and Serbia ranks 43rd of 47 countries.
Armenia has averaged higher in every one of the 1 decades both report.

About this data
Monetary policy framework comprises the structures in place that enable and guide the conduct of monetary policy. In this project, we provide a multidimensional characterization of monetary policy frameworks across three pillars: Independence and Accountability, Policy and Operational Strategy, and Communications (IAPOC). This database covers 50 advanced economies, emerging markets, and low-income developing countries, from 2007 to 2018 (being extended).
